Description:
Bisoxazoline, with the CAS number 36697-72-0, is a chemical compound characterized by its unique structure that features two oxazoline rings. This compound is typically used as a ligand in coordination chemistry and catalysis, particularly in asymmetric synthesis. It is known for its ability to form stable complexes with transition metals, which enhances its utility in various catalytic processes. Bisoxazoline is often synthesized from readily available precursors and is valued for its high purity, often specified at 97% or greater. The compound is generally solid at room temperature and may exhibit moderate solubility in organic solvents. Its reactivity can be influenced by the presence of substituents on the oxazoline rings, which can affect its coordination properties and catalytic activity. Safety data sheets indicate that, like many chemical substances, it should be handled with care, using appropriate personal protective equipment to avoid inhalation or skin contact. Overall, bisoxazoline is an important compound in the field of organic and inorganic chemistry, particularly in the development of new synthetic methodologies.
Formula:C6H8N2O2
InChI:InChI=1/C6H8N2O2/c1-3-9-5(7-1)6-8-2-4-10-6/h1-4H2
SMILES:C1COC(=N1)C1=NCCO1
Synonyms:- 2,2-Bis(2-oxazoline)
- 4,4',5,5'-Tetrahydro-2,2'-Bi-1,3-Oxazole
